Jasmine Lovely George

India

A lawyer by training, Jasmine is a self-declared feminist activist who uses her legal acumen to improve the sexual and reproductive health and rights of women and girls in India. She is interested in leveraging new technologies such as virtual reality, and seeks to create audio podcasts in Hindi for youth populations in spaces where talking about sexuality is taboo.

Bodies and Cities is a pilot project that aims to develop a radio show that specifically discusses issues related to Sexual and Reproductive health that are relevant for Indian youth. Bodies and Cities will be implemented together with juveniles of Observational Homes in South of Bangalore, as part of Centre for Child and Law and Community Radio. Targeted end-users will be juveniles below the age of 18 years old. Recorded podcasts would be used in a 6-month radio show and in YP Foundation-sponsored workshops within the community reaching beneficiaries of all ages.
